MAID Losses Declining

MAID Losses Declining

Third quarter results for electronic information provider MAID have shown that pre-tax losses have declined from £3.386 million last year to £2.374 million this year. Turnover also increased from £3.788m to £5.178m, up 64% on the same period last year.

Annual renewals stand at 85% and Michael Mander, chairman of MAID, said that new business services would be launched early next year. He also stated his hope that there would be a significantly improved performance in the last quarter of this year.
